Output 611d56fe66cb2505f72625c786a719b4fdd124196b6dc65320d4e1f626dedae7:1

value
669855310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efb68eebee4ff8dbdda060dcc1ac1071553f7a87 OP_EQUALVERIFY OP_CHECKSIG
address
1NrVCDjw92HTcRAy4Ja63bHzYm5GmegYVx
transaction
611d56fe66cb2505f72625c786a719b4fdd124196b6dc65320d4e1f626dedae7
spent
true